VBA代码使用单元格值在excel的列表框中选择并显示命名范围

时间:2015-05-20 07:23:47

标签: excel-vba vba excel

平 我希望A1单元格值指向一个命名范围并在列表框中显示。 A1中的值是文本,它对应于价格表中许多命名范围之一。如果我选择例如价值' list1'在单元格A1中,相应的命名范围显示在列表框中。如何在Excel中使用VBA执行此操作?

1 个答案:

答案 0 :(得分:0)

我认为VBA解决方案:
创建一个具有指定范围的数量的数组 将命名范围中的每个单元格值添加到相应的数组位置
用逗号连接数组并将结果字符串添加到单元格的验证规则中。